Deliver the amulet and you get some gear.
What do you like to play? If you like spell casting, join the mages guild right away/ just visit any city and start the quests. You need to get a recommendation from the head of each Mage guildhouse in each city. You can then make your own spells. It's great for leveling up casting skills. You can make a 1 mana spell and just chain cast.
I tend to just do the main quest and wander about. You need to sleep to level up. I didn't know that at first.

Archery is kinda underpowered in Oblivion. I suggest just running the main quest and any side-quests that you come along in the order that you feel like doing them, it doesn't matter much. The world stays available after you complete the main quest.
If you have difficulty with the game be sure to sleep every once in a while so you can actually level up, and to level up you just go outside the gates and start hunting. Look for caves or ruins and just kill & loot errything for XP, money and loot to sell for money.
If you're still having difficulties turn the difficulty down from the menu.

You should plan out your leveling to maximize your stat gains.
Id do Kvatch right away. It's fairly easy, and gets you some ok gear (a nice light armor chest piece). The oblivion gate isn't tough. Just save a lot. The last guy is a little tough, but I've beaten him at level 1 many times.
